Types of Eyeglasses
Glasses come in various styles, each designed to satisfy distinct visual needs. Rx eyeglasses are tailored for people who demand vision correction. They can handle different conditions such as myopia, farsightedness, and astigmatism. These glasses are precisely crafted with lenses that are customized based on the individual's prescription, ensuring sharp and pleasant vision.
In addition to conventional prescription glasses, there are specialized options like progressive lens eyeglasses and options designed for astigmatism. Progressive lenses provide a smooth transition between multiple prescriptions, enabling wearers to see distinctly at various distances without the necessity for multiple pairs. On the flip side, eyeglasses for irregular vision are particularly shaped to fix the unique curvature of the eye, providing enhanced precise vision for individuals affected by this issue.

Glasses vs. Contacts
When it comes to vision correction, glasses and contacts are the most popular choices. Glasses provide a straightforward solution for individuals looking to enhance their sight. They offer ease of use, requiring no special application techniques, and can be easily put on or removed. Additionally, glasses come in many styles, allowing wearers to display their personal fashion sense while also addressing particular vision needs, such as astigmatism or the need for progressive lenses.
On the other hand, contacts offer a less noticeable alternative for vision correction. They sit closely on the eye, which can provide a wider field of vision without the frame obstruction that comes with glasses. Contact lenses may be preferred by people who engage in sports or varied physical activities, as they reduce the risk of breaking glasses during movement. They can also be fitted with multiple features, including choices for those with vision irregularities or who prefer multifocal solutions.
Both eyeglasses and contacts have their benefits and drawbacks, and the choice often comes down to personal preference and lifestyle. Factors such as comfort, practicality, and appearance can greatly influence the decision. It's important to consider how each option fits into daily routines, with some individuals opting for a combination of both, utilizing contacts during active days and glasses during leisure or home time.
